A rear view camera kit is an essential safety feature in modern vehicles, designed to assist drivers by providing a clear view of the area directly behind the vehicle. These kits typically consist of a camera mounted at the rear of the car, a display screen located inside the vehicle, and the necessary wiring to connect the two components. The camera captures real-time video footage, which is transmitted to the display screen, allowing the driver to see obstacles that might not be visible through traditional rearview mirrors.
According to a report from the National Highway Traffic Safety Administration (NHTSA), studies show that rear view cameras can significantly reduce the risk of backover accidents. In fact, it is estimated that these accidents result in approximately 292 fatalities and 14,000 injuries each year in the United States alone. By providing a wider field of vision and eliminating blind spots, rear view camera kits enhance situational awareness, especially in crowded parking lots or driveways. The implementation of such safety technology not only benefits drivers but also protects pedestrians, particularly children and senior citizens, who are most vulnerable during these types of incidents.
Rear view camera kits are essential technological advancements designed to enhance driving safety. These kits typically include a camera mounted on the rear of the vehicle and a display screen located inside where the driver can easily see it. When the vehicle is put in reverse, the camera activates, providing a live feed of the area directly behind the car. This picture drastically reduces blind spots and helps drivers detect obstacles or pedestrians that may not be visible through traditional mirrors, thereby preventing accidents.
The technology behind rear view camera kits largely relies on high-resolution imaging and wide-angle lenses, which capture a broader view of the area behind the vehicle. Many systems also incorporate features like grid lines, which aid in parking by illustrating the vehicle's trajectory. Additionally, some advanced kits use sensors that alert drivers to potential obstacles with audible warnings, further enhancing situational awareness. This combination of visual and auditory cues empowers drivers to make safer decisions while reversing, significantly contributing to overall roadway safety for both drivers and pedestrians alike.

Installing a rear view camera kit in your vehicle can enhance your driving experience by providing better visibility while reversing. The installation process typically begins with gathering all necessary tools and components, which may include the camera, display monitor, wiring harness, and mounting brackets. First, you'll want to locate the best mounting spot for the camera, usually above the rear license plate, ensuring it has a clear view of the area behind your vehicle. Using a drill, you can secure the camera in place, taking care to preserve the waterproofing features.
Next, you'll need to run the wiring from the camera to the display monitor, which is typically mounted on the dashboard or rearview mirror. This involves carefully routing the wires through the vehicle’s interior, ensuring they are hidden and secure. It's essential to connect the power supply to the camera—often through the vehicle's reverse light—so the camera activates automatically when the vehicle is put in reverse. Following these steps will not only improve your ability to detect obstacles while reversing but also contribute significantly to overall driving safety.

Rear view cameras offer a significant upgrade over traditional mirrors, primarily in terms of visibility and safety. While traditional mirrors provide a limited field of view, rear view cameras present a comprehensive image of the area behind the vehicle. This expanded perspective reduces blind spots, allowing drivers to be more aware of their surroundings, particularly when reversing. Unlike mirrors, which can be obstructed by headrests or passengers, rear view cameras deliver a clear view, enabling safer navigation in tight spaces or crowded environments.
The integration of rear view cameras into vehicles also enhances driver confidence. Many modern systems include additional features like grid lines to assist with parking, which help drivers judge distances more accurately. Drivers can monitor real-time video feed, providing a dynamic view instead of relying solely on fixed mirrors. This technology can be especially beneficial in urban areas or for larger vehicles, where maneuvering can be challenging. Overall, the adoption of rear view cameras significantly improves driving safety by offering superior visibility compared to traditional mirrors, empowering drivers to make better-informed decisions on the road.
